How Do You Debug JavaScript With Chrome DevTools? Have you ever faced difficulties when trying to identify and fix issues in your JavaScript code? In this comprehensive video, we'll guide you through the process of debugging JavaScript using Chrome DevTools. You'll learn how to set breakpoints, step through your code, and inspect variables to understand exactly what your code is doing at each step. We’ll cover how to reproduce bugs, pause execution at critical points, and analyze asynchronous functions such as promises and async/await. Additionally, you'll discover how to use conditional breakpoints and logpoints to monitor specific conditions without cluttering your code with console logs. We’ll also show you how to monitor errors in real-time by enabling Pause on Exceptions and using the Console panel for running quick commands. Debugging is an essential skill for web developers, especially when working with complex or asynchronous code. By mastering these Chrome DevTools features, you'll be able to troubleshoot issues more efficiently, improve your error handling, and write more reliable JavaScript.
